Root Oxidation On Closure Joint of Stainless Steel

07/12/2012 9:29 AM

I am facing oxidation problems in case of the last joint welding in case of Stainless steel piping modification due to insufficient purging. Purging is more difficult in case of the gas pipes where wtare soluable dams cannot be installed. any suggestions???

Re: Root Oxidation On Closure Joint of Stainless Steel

07/12/2012 10:28 PM

If you can't set up dams there are a few other options.

.

1. Using backing flux and fluxed filler. The downside if you can't access the interior post weld, is the flux chips off and contaminates what is in the pipe. Also the spaces created in the chipped flux can cause problems.

.

2. Backing ring insert. With a reasonable fit, an acceptable weld is easy to achieve. The problem with this is the inherent crevice.

.

3. Finesse with local purging and techniques to minimizes necessary time and heat applied. This includes varying local purge gas temperature and application to minimize O2 content locally inside the pipe. Also pulsed GTAW, should be used to minimized the heat necessary for complete penetration as well as reducing time required to complete root pass.

.

4. RDM. Regulated Metal Deposition. This process uses a venturi effect to draw shield gas smoothly to the back side of the weld pool. Miller markets some technology using this process specifically for welding stainless pipe without a back purge.

.

Hope that helps.
